Festive Lighting: Setting the Mood for Christmas in Your Bathroom
Candles and Tealights: A Warm, Inviting Glow
Candles add a touch of romance and warmth to any room, especially during the holiday season. Consider scented candles with festive fragrances like pine, cinnamon, or gingerbread. Scatter tealights around the bathroom for a magical, flickering ambiance.
Arrange candles safely on heat-resistant surfaces and never leave them unattended. Different candle heights add visual interest. Consider using candle holders of varying materials like glass, metal, or wood.
For a more luxurious feel, opt for pillar candles or tapered candles in festive colors. These can be placed on a mantelpiece or windowsill for a dramatic effect.
Fairy Lights: A Touch of Enchantment
Fairy lights are a versatile and affordable way to add a magical touch to your bathroom decor for Christmas. Drape them around mirrors, towel racks, or shower curtains. Consider battery-operated lights for convenience and safety.
Experiment with different colors of fairy lights. White lights create a classic, elegant atmosphere. While colored lights add a playful, festive touch.
For a more sophisticated look, choose fairy lights with warm white LEDs. These provide a soft, inviting glow without being overpowering.
String Lights: Adding a Rustic Charm
String lights add a rustic, charming touch to bathroom Christmas decor. Hang them across the ceiling or along walls for a warm, inviting feel. Ensure the lights are suitable for bathroom use and are protected from moisture.
Combine string lights with other festive decorations like ornaments or greenery. Different sizes and styles of bulbs can create visual interest.
For a unique look, try using string lights with different bulb shapes or colors. Consider incorporating pinecones or other natural elements into the design.
Christmas-Themed Towels and Accessories: Simple yet Effective
Adding Christmas-themed towels and accessories is a quick and easy way to add some festive cheer to your bathroom. Consider festive hand towels, bath mats, and shower curtains. These small touches instantly elevate the holiday atmosphere.
Choose towels with festive prints or embroideries, such as snowflakes, Christmas trees, or Santa Claus. Match them with coordinating bath mats and shower curtains for a cohesive look. To maintain a clean and organized look, select storage baskets and containers showcasing holiday themes.
Look for high-quality towels that are both absorbent and comfortable. Avoid towels with harsh dyes or chemicals. Choose natural fibers like cotton or bamboo, which are softer on the skin.
Festive Greenery: Bringing the Outdoors In
Incorporate natural elements like pine branches, holly, and ivy to bring the outdoors in. Arrange them in a vase or basket for a rustic touch. Remember to choose greenery that is safe for your bathroom environment and avoid materials that could mold or mildew in damp conditions.
Combine greenery with candles or fairy lights for a magical ambiance. Strategically place greenery near mirrors or windows to maximize their visual impact. For a more modern feel, consider incorporating minimal greenery arrangements in sleek containers.
Pine cones and winter berries add texture and color. Consider using faux greenery if you're concerned about maintenance or allergies. Many realistic-looking options are available.
Ornaments and Decorations: Adding a Sparkling Touch
Hang small, lightweight ornaments from the showerhead or towel rack. Use delicate decorations to avoid damaging your bathroom fixtures. Choose ornaments that reflect the overall decorating style of your bathroom.
Place small Christmas figurines or decorative items on shelves or countertops. Consider using decorative containers or trays to organize the items and add to the overall design. Explore using items that are functional, like decorative soap dispensers or toothbrush holders.
For a unique touch, incorporate personalized ornaments or family heirlooms. This adds sentimental value and makes your bathroom feel even cozier. Remember that not every ornament is suitable for a bathroom environment, so choose items that can withstand moisture.
DIY Christmas Bathroom Decor: Unleash Your Creativity
Creating your own Christmas decorations can be a fun and rewarding experience. Consider making simple crafts like paper snowflakes or pom-poms. These add a personal touch and can be tailored to your bathroom aesthetic.
Upcycle items you already have, such as old jars or bottles, and transform them into festive containers for cotton balls or soap. Explore tutorials online for inspiration and guidance.
Get creative with materials like cinnamon sticks, pine cones, and cranberries. These natural elements add a rustic, organic feel to your bathroom. Remember safety when using sharp objects or hot glue guns.
Color Schemes for Christmas Bathroom Decor
Classic red and green is a popular choice, but consider other festive color palettes, such as silver and gold for a glamorous look, or blues and whites for a winter wonderland theme. Ensure the color scheme complements your existing bathroom decor.
Consider using a color wheel to choose complementary colors. Incorporate these colors through towels, decorations, and lighting. Balance bold colors with neutrals to prevent the space from feeling overwhelming.
Choose colors that evoke a sense of calm and relaxation, such as soft blues or greens. These colors can create a spa-like ambiance, perfect for unwinding after a busy day.
Bathroom Decor Ideas for Christmas: Focusing on Functionality
While aesthetics are crucial, remember functionality. Incorporate practical storage solutions for toiletries and towels, decorated with festive touches. This helps maintain a clean and organized space.
Use decorative trays or baskets to store items such as soaps, candles, and cotton balls. Organize toiletries efficiently to prevent clutter. Choose storage solutions that are both aesthetically pleasing and functional.
Ensure everything is easily accessible and within reach. Clutter can detract from the overall festive ambiance; maintain an organized space to enhance your bathroom's festive look.
Maintaining a Festive Yet Functional Bathroom
Remember, safety should be your top priority. Keep candles and lights away from water sources and ensure they're placed on stable surfaces. Regularly check light fixtures and cords for any damage.
To maintain the festive look, take care of your decorations. Regularly dust or wipe down your ornaments and greenery. Replace any damaged or worn decorations as needed.
A well-lit bathroom enhances the overall aesthetic, creating a festive mood while ensuring safety. Consider using a dimmer switch to adjust the lighting according to your preference.
Choosing the Right Christmas Decorations for Your Bathroom
Consider the size of your bathroom when selecting decorations. Avoid overcrowding the space with too many items. This helps in maintaining a clean and uncluttered environment.
Select materials that are durable and can withstand moisture. Avoid using materials that could mold or mildew in damp conditions. Choose waterproof, or moisture resistant options.
Opt for decorations that complement your bathroom’s overall style. This ensures your Christmas decor enhances, rather than clashes with, the existing aesthetic.
Incorporating Different Christmas Themes into Your Bathroom
A traditional Christmas theme is always a reliable choice, but exploring other styles can add unique charm. A rustic theme using natural materials like wood and pinecones can complement a farmhouse-style bathroom. A modern minimalist theme can feature sleek silver and white decorations, creating clean lines and a sleek look.
